Output 258a95e0272d0233da46f86959795687e3726f06b40d31a504c74265ab370f76:3

value
13739455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0a3cc5b057ec14cae77cc88eb5fd6ee2b0b125 OP_EQUAL
address
3L7JgbkR6uimEg6dVbGwt3jAffJNAVRhSx
transaction
258a95e0272d0233da46f86959795687e3726f06b40d31a504c74265ab370f76
spent
true